Pricing
What the per-head price already includes
- The chef, on site and cooking, for the whole event
- All cooking equipment, gas and refrigeration
- Gazebo, lighting, power and hand-washing facilities
- Serving tables, dressed, and disposable service ware
- Travel within about 60 miles of Cambridge
- Full clear-down and removal of all our waste
Priced separately, and always before you pay
Travel beyond 60 miles
A fuel contribution, quoted as a figure rather than a per-mile rate.
China, glassware and linen
An add-on at £225 for the event, when disposables will not do.
Staffed bar service
£450 for a licensed bar team, glassware and chilled storage.
Bespoke menus
Anything Adam writes for you specially is quoted on its own merits.
Children under twelve are charged at half the per-head rate and under-fives are free. The booking terms set out deposits, balances and cancellations in full.
